Orangutans and Sun Bears

Our main aim in visiting Sepilok was to see the rehabilitation centres. Lucky for us, we had already seen orangutans in Sarawak and Sumatra, so this was a real bonus.

The morning feeding session attracted hundreds of tourists. Unluckily for them the orangutans didn’t show up! Evidently they have plenty of fruit available in the jungle, so don’t need to visit the feeding platform! (We waited over an hour just in case.)

So we went to the Sun Bear centre across the road. This is a really informative facility, and around 50 bears are cared for. Many have been traumatised and badly mistreated. Some will be released back into the wild, but most live their lives in this sanctuary.

In the afternoon we headed back to the Nursery to watch the young orangutans learn survival skills from the older ones. They are fabulous to watch!

Finally, with a smaller crowd in attendance, the animals came to feed. We spent an hour watching their interactions, it was a fantastic experience.
